what is difference in between Attitude and Behaviour?
Answer Posted / kalpana singh
Attitude is internal, although it often shows on the
outside - as behaviour.
Behaviour is external - and can be observed.
Thus, Attitude is a state of mind and behavior is a Act
that develop by attitude
